The latest U.S. federal push into quantum technology involves a $2 billion allocation, with several recipients drawing attention due to their political affiliations. According to a recent report by the Financial Times, one of the beneficiaries is a startup backed by a firm that has ties to the Trump family. Another recipient is a company that was taken public by a former Pentagon official. The investment initiative is part of broader efforts to bolster domestic quantum computing capabilities, a field considered critical for national security and economic competitiveness. The selection of these particular companies has sparked discussions about the influence of political connections in federal funding decisions. The report did not disclose the specific names of the companies or the exact amounts allocated to each, but it highlighted the involvement of individuals and entities associated with the previous administration. The $2 billion figure represents a significant federal commitment to quantum research and development, an area where the U.S. competes with China and other nations. From a professional perspective, the involvement of politically connected entities in major federal investments may introduce governance and transparency considerations. While such ties are not inherently problematic, they could lead to calls for stricter conflict-of-interest rules in technology funding. Investors and market participants should note that federal quantum spending is expected to grow, but the allocation process may become more politically sensitive. Companies with explicit political links could face heightened regulatory or media attention, potentially affecting their valuation or ability to secure future contracts. However, the broader quantum sector remains attractive due to its long-term potential. The $2 billion injection is part of a multiyear strategy, and returns are likely to materialize only over a decade or more. As with any early-stage technology, the risks are substantial, and selective disclosure of political connections may influence investor sentiment in the short term.
